Clerk of Works

AtkinsRéalis is one of the world’s leading providers of engineering professional consulting and support services with offices across Ireland.
We are seeking to recruit candidates with experience fulfilling the duties of Clerk of Works / Inspector for a high-profile road / cycling / active travel scheme in the east of Galway City, for an estimated 18 to 24 months, commencing construction in Summer 2024.
Desirable skills/attributes:
- A minimum of 5 years’ experience in a similar role.
- Experience of ensuring works are compliant with the Works Requirements and Road Specifications.
- A good record keeper.
- Enthusiastic, hardworking and flexible.
- Willing to take responsibility and comfortable working as part of a team.
- An excellent communicator, written and verbal in English.
Primary Duties will include:
- Act as Clerk of Works / Inspector on behalf of the Designers’ Site Team, based on-site to oversee quality and compliance of works.
- Ensure that reports and related photographic records are maintained of all works including covered works prior to closing up.
- Inspecting construction work and comparing it with drawings and specifications.
- Measuring and quality checking materials.
- Identifying defects and liaison with designers / contractor regarding solutions.
- Monitoring progress and reporting to the Senior Resident Engineer (full-time on-site), Resident Engineer (full time on-site) and Employer’s Representative (office based).
- Keeping detailed records of work.
- Referring to plans and taking photographs of work, along with measurements and samples.
- Liaising with contractors, engineers, and surveyors.
- Highlighting issues related to health, safety and the environment.
Terms and Conditions:
- Competitive salary subject to experience.
- A vehicle will be provided for the duration of the works.
- 25 days annual leave, with the option to purchase an additional 5 days.
- Working week of 8hrs per day, 5 days per week; with possibility of some weekend and night works (only if and when required).
